Hoplitoplacenticeras (Hoplitoplacenticeras) marroti
Taxonomy
Ammonites marroti was named by Coquand (1859) [DISTRIBUTION: Campanian; Europe.]. It is not a trace fossil.
It was recombined as Hoplitoplacenticeras marroti by Howarth (1965), Atabekyan and Khakimov (1976) and Kennedy (1986); it was recombined as Hoplitoplacenticeras (Hoplitoplacenticeras) marroti by Kennedy et al. (1992).
